IMAG0087Last night I went to Blick in Pasadena to pick up some art supplies. It’s a great store and I love shopping for art supplies. The only problem I have is restraining myself and trying to keep to a budget. At the end of the year I’ll be adding up all the income and expenses and hoping to make a hefty profit. This year I’ve decided to make it easier, usually I keep all the art supply receipts in an envelope (at least the ones I remember), this year I’ll be using Mint’s tagging feature to mark specific purchases as art related expenses. Rather than go into detail here’s a link to a Mint FAQ about using tags.

I ended up purchasing some gesso, matte medium and three 12 x 12 panels, which is exciting because I haven’t been painting lately.

Mirrored Society is pleased to present Point Suite, a group exhibition, which includes works by artists, Annika Connor, Teodor Dumitrescu, Jeff Musser, and John Otter. Point Suite Contemporary Art book will accompany the exhibition and will be available for purchase.

ABOUT POINT SUITE

Point Suite Contemporary Art Book showcases the conscious and subconscious thought processes of artists in our time. The artists have created a reflection of our culture and by peering into this reflection we are able to understand what future generations will see when they look back at us. The ideas presented in this book are in the form of paintings, sculptures, prints, photographs, and essays.

ABOUT MIRRORED SOCIETY

Mirrored Society is a bookstore and gallery focused on the arts consisting of both new and rare titles. Our collection is carefully selected to present a genuine representation of the arts. Mirrored Society continues to grow according to its founding principles of exploration and friendship, working with like-minded individuals to forge a creative environment that reaches far beyond.

A peek inside the (travel) sketchbook

I recently returned from a week of travels which began in Seattle and ended in Portland. I took a sketchbook and some new supplies: conté and charcoal pencils.

It was a great trip and I’m happy I took my travel sketchbook. I really enjoyed the feel of conté, I haven’t used it in years. I wanted a medium that was somewhat loose but not too messy.
